Antes Surname Meaning
German: from a vernacular form common in the Rhineland of the personal name Anton Latin Antonius (see Anthony) a variant of Anthes. German: humanistic surname a Hellenization of Blume literally ‘flower’ (see Blum) with reference to the Greek word anthos ‘flower’. Compare Andes and Andis.
Dutch: from the personal name Ant(e) a short form of the ancient Germanic names such as Andbert with genitive inflection -s. Dutch: alternatively perhaps a variant of Antens itself possibly from a vernacular form of Antoons a patronymic from Antonius (see Anton).
Source: Dictionary of American Family Names 2nd edition, 2022
